Transaction ebe311625dc55490a22f2f83c3be1ac04a7c5a43a12c833c37cefae83f847d23
1 Input
2 Outputs
- ebe311625dc55490a22f2f83c3be1ac04a7c5a43a12c833c37cefae83f847d23:0
- ebe311625dc55490a22f2f83c3be1ac04a7c5a43a12c833c37cefae83f847d23:1
value 1051
address 13SodTHpE5FE4gkBfGwV1UFLGE83cEo2UB
value 112788157
address 16BKpxqkVgDAgZvYdRCBmPqd2mA456ihb4